Business administration professionals are vital to the success of any organization. They are responsible for managing the day-to-day operations and ensuring that the organization is meeting its goals and objectives. Those with a business administration degree have a wide range of skills and knowledge that can be used in a variety of different positions, making them an invaluable asset to any organization.

Business administration professionals are also responsible for developing and implementing strategies for achieving organizational goals. This may involve analyzing the internal and external environment, creating plans and programs, and developing policies and procedures. They also may be responsible for conducting research and developing plans to respond to market trends and customer needs. Business administration professionals are also often responsible for managing projects and ensuring that they are completed on time and within budget. They may be in charge of developing project plans, delegating tasks, and monitoring progress.
File system usage command in Unix The file system usage command in Unix, also known as the df command, is a powerful and versatile tool used to check the disk usage of a file system. The command provides an overview of the space used, the space available, and other useful information. It is an essential part of system maintenance and can help prevent the system from running out of space. The df command is used to check the disk usage of a file system. It can be used to check the total space used, the total space available, and the percentage of the file system that is used. It can also be used to check the mount points used on a system and the type of file system used. The df command is often used in combination with other commands such as du, which can be used to check the disk usage of individual files and directories. It is also used in conjunction with the find command, which can be used to locate files and directories. Using the df command is relatively straightforward. To use the command, type “df” followed by the name or path of the file system you want to check. For example, to check the disk usage of the root file system, you would use the command “df /”. The command will return information on the total space used, the total space available, and the percentage of the file system that is used. The df command can also be used with the -h option. This will give the output in a human-readable format. This makes it easier to understand the usage information. The df command is an essential tool for managing file systems. It can help prevent the system from running out of space and can provide useful information on the usage of the file system. It is a powerful and versatile command and should be used regularly to keep the system running smoothly.

Business administration professionals are respon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of a company and ensuring that everything is running smoothly. They typically manage a team of staff members, set goals and objectives, and analyze data to make decisions that will benefit the organization. The job duties of a business administrator typically include budgeting and financial management.
